Manama: The General Command of the Bahrain Defence Force (BDF) has reported a significant defensive achievement, announcing that its air defense systems have intercepted and destroyed 154 ballistic missiles and 350 drones since the beginning of Iranian attacks targeting the Kingdom of Bahrain.
According to Bahrain News Agency, the General Command expressed pride in the combat readiness and vigilance of BDF personnel, highlighting their sustained operational effectiveness in safeguarding the nation's airspace. The General Command has reassured citizens that the Kingdom's skies remain secure under the capable watch of its defense forces.
In light of ongoing threats, the General Command has advised the public to exercise caution for personal safety. Specific guidelines include avoiding affected areas and suspicious objects, refraining from filming military operations or debris, and steering clear of spreading unverified information. Citizens are encouraged to rely solely on official and government media for accurate updates and advisories.
The General Command also highlighted that the use of ballistic missiles and drones against civilian areas and private property violates international humanitarian law and the United Nations Charter. These actions pose a direct threat to regional peace and stability, further emphasizing the need for vigilance and caution among residents.
